A Step-by-Step Guide on How to Start a Successful Marketing Agency

Starting a marketing agency can be a lucrative and rewarding venture. The good news is that it doesn’t require a significant capital investment and has the potential to scale into a successful business. However, building a marketing agency is not without challenges. From finding talented individuals to building strong client relationships, there are various nuances to consider. In this article, we will provide you with a step-by-step guide on starting your own marketing agency, so you can go from freelancer to CEO.

Step 1: Establish Your Positioning By Selecting One Niche and One Service

To increase profitability and gain traction faster, it’s crucial to specialise in one niche and offer one specific service. While the temptation to offer a wide range of marketing services to different types of businesses may be there, focusing on a specialised service allows you to deliver higher quality work and stand out from your competitors. By becoming an expert in a particular service for a specific type of business, you can charge higher rates and generate more organic referrals.

Step 2: Close Your First Client

The success of your marketing agency is dependent on acquiring your first client. Instead of spending time building a website or designing a logo, prioritise getting your first client. One effective strategy is to identify well-connected industry influencers and offer to provide your services for free in exchange for referrals. Not only does this establish a strong client roster, but it also allows you to build an impressive portfolio with notable samples to showcase potential clients.

Step 3: Collect Feedback And Level Up Your Skills

Delivering outstanding results to your clients is crucial in securing their satisfaction and gaining referrals. Collecting feedback from clients and measuring your results is essential in improving your services and accelerating your rate of learning. Survey your customers and ask for their thoughts on your work and what they find most valuable. Additionally, hire a coach or join a peer group to seek guidance and learn from experienced professionals in the field. Keep experimenting and refining your approach to stay ahead of the curve.

Step 4: Create Documented Systems And Processes

Once you have honed your skills and can consistently produce exceptional results for your clients, it’s time to create documented systems and processes. This allows you to deliver the same level of quality and maintain customer satisfaction as you grow and hire more employees. Start by outlining the steps involved in your main marketing service and the strategies employed at each step. These guides can be simple Google Docs or blog posts that act as both internal process guides and sales and marketing tools.

Step 5: Find And Retain Excellent Talent

As your marketing agency expands, it becomes crucial to find and retain exceptional talent. Your skilled expertise combined with documented systems will make it easier to train and onboard new employees. Building a team of talented individuals ensures that your agency continues to deliver excellent results to clients. Remember to invest time in hiring individuals who align with your agency’s vision and values.


Starting a marketing agency can be a rewarding journey, but it requires careful planning and execution. By following this step-by-step guide, you can establish a successful marketing agency from the ground up. Focus on selecting a niche, delivering exceptional results, and building strong client relationships. With dedication and continuous improvement, your marketing agency has the potential to thrive and become a leader in the industry.

